Output 84ac440dd731120dfd85d8a46e45a4e7b5a52d26366c467d6ef9f52b59ccc837:5

value
156411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 081fa80b176ea4b59bb11c243db495f3dedfe291 OP_EQUAL
address
32RyFc3MsuRVx1ivPixkuHYK4zTk11pRAh
transaction
84ac440dd731120dfd85d8a46e45a4e7b5a52d26366c467d6ef9f52b59ccc837
confirmations
98424
spent
true